<?php
$n = 8;
$min = 1;
$max = 100;
$data = createData($n, $min, $max);
echo "随机生成数组:";
print_r($data);
echo "<br />";
bubble_sort($data, $n);
//生成一个随机数组成的不重复数组
function createData($n, $min, $max){
$bigarr = range($min, $max);
$arrkey = array_rand($bigarr, $n); //返回键名
for($i=0; $i<count($arrkey); $i++){
$arr[] = $bigarr[$arrkey[$i]];
}
return $arr;
}
//冒泡排序函数
function bubble_sort($data, $n)
{
$flag = 0;
for($i=0; $i<$n-1; $i++){
for($j=0; $j<$n-$i-1; $j++){
if($data[$j+1] < $data[$j]){
$flag = 1;
$temp = $data[$j];
$data[$j] = $data[$j+1];
$data[$j+1] = $temp;
}
}
if (!$flag){
break;
}
$flag = 0;
echo "排序过程 ".($i+1)." 步:";
print_r($data);
echo "<br/>";
}
echo "排序后的结果:";
print_r($data);
}
?>
#include<iostream>
#include<stdlib.h>
#include<time.h>
using namespace std;
int createData(int arr[], int n, int min, int max);
void bubble_sort(int *a, int n);
int main()
{
int arr[100];
int n=6;
int min=2;
int max=12;
createData(arr, n, min, max);
for (int i=0; i<n; i++)
cout << arr[i] << " ";
cout << endl;
bubble_sort(arr, n);
for (int j=0; j<n; j++)
cout << arr[j] << " ";
cout << endl;
return 1;
}
//生成一个随机数组成的不重复数组
int createData(int arr[], int n, int min, int max)
{
srand(time(NULL));
int i,j,flag;
for(i=0; i<n; i++){
do{
int num = min + rand()%(max-min+1);
arr[i] = num;
flag = 0;
for(j=0; j<i; j++){
if( arr[i] == arr[j])
flag = 1;
}
}while(flag);
}
return 1;
}
//冒泡排序函数
void bubble_sort(int *a, int n)
{
bool flag = true;
int k = n;
while(flag)
{
flag = false;
for(int i=1; i<k; i++)
{
if(a[i-1] > a[i])
{
int tmp = a[i];
a[i] = a[i-1];
a[i-1] = tmp;
flag = true;
}
}
k--;
}
}
